How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Riva Trace?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Riva Trace Studio Apartments | $1,473 | $1,135 | $1,888 |
| Riva Trace 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,927 | $1,290 | $4,196 |
| Riva Trace 2 Bedroom Apartments | $2,293 | $1,450 | $5,250 |
| Riva Trace 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,475 | $1,895 | $4,687 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Pet Friendly Riva Trace Apartments
How much is the average rent for a Pet Friendly Riva Trace Apartment?
The average rent for a Pet Friendly Apartment in Riva Trace is $2,257.
What is the largest Pet Friendly Riva Trace Apartment for rent?
Today's Pet Friendly apartment with the most square footage in Riva Trace is a 1,574 square feet unit starting from $1,445 at Magnolia Estates.
What is the average size for Riva Trace Pet Friendly Apartments for rent?
The average size for a Pet Friendly rental in Riva Trace is currently at 716 sq ft.
